  • Time course of bone marrow derived cells from mice stimulated with RANKL to generate osteoclasts

    Mus musculus Mus musculus

    The receptor activator of NF-B ligand (TNFSF11/RANKL) produced by osteoblasts and activated immune cells initiates the development of osteoclasts in the bone marrow. Using time course expression data, the intrinsic processes and the extrinsic factors that control osteoclastogenesis were identified.
